Get Spreadsheet Info
Get the structure of a Google Spreadsheet — worksheet names, column headers (first row of each sheet), and row counts. Call this first before reading or writing data, so you know the worksheet names and column headers. The column headers are used as keys when writing data with Add Rows or Update Rows. The spreadsheet ID is the long string in the Google Sheets URL:
https://docs.google.com/spreadsheets/d/{spreadsheetId}/edit.- Action

Connect a user's Google Sheets account once, then configure and run Get Spreadsheet Info from your backend or agent.
import { PipedreamClient } from "@pipedream/sdk"
const pd = new PipedreamClient({
projectId: process.env.PIPEDREAM_PROJECT_ID!,
clientId: process.env.PIPEDREAM_CLIENT_ID!,
clientSecret: process.env.PIPEDREAM_CLIENT_SECRET!,
projectEnvironment: "production",
})
const result = await pd.actions.run({
id: "google_sheets-get-spreadsheet-info",
externalUserId: "{external_user_id}", // any stable ID for this user in your system
configuredProps: {
google_sheets: { authProvisionId: "apn_xxxxxxx" },
spreadsheetId: "Spreadsheet ID",
},
})
console.log(result)curl -X POST https://api.pipedream.com/v1/connect/{project_id}/actions/run \
